At the core of any 3D device control system are GNSS receivers and antennas, capturing satellite signals to determine the machine's specific area. Onboard computer systems and control boxes process this information and interact with the equipment.

The final equipment components are hydraulic systems and control bars, converting digital directions right into physical movements. 3D modelling software application develops detailed strategies, which are then fed right into the machine control software application to assist the equipment.


This includes establishing GNSS receivers, adjusting sensing units, and setting up the machine control software program. Once set up, the system is incorporated with existing equipment for real-time changes and advice. The magic of 3D maker control lies in its real-time information collection and processing. GNSS and other sensors constantly collect setting information, which is corrected for errors to supply reliable and accurate support.


Individual user interfaces give real-time updates on the machine's setting and needed adjustments, making certain accurate control. In building and construction, 3D device control is utilized for earthmoving, grading, paving, and excavation, guaranteeing jobs are finished to exact specifications.

3D maker control significantly boosts effectiveness by decreasing rework and minimising material wastefulness, leading to quicker and much more cost-effective job completion. The innovation makes certain every job is implemented specifically as intended, resulting in continually premium job. One of the most engaging advantages of 3D maker control is the considerable expense savings it supplies.


Gas intake is optimised due to the fact that machines run better and avoid unneeded motions. Upkeep costs are additionally lowered, as the machinery experiences much less damage because of precise procedure. In general, these cost savings add to a much more lucrative bottom line for any task. By minimizing human mistake and limiting exposure to dangerous environments, 3D device control improves employee safety and reduces crashes.

Maker control systems give beneficial benefits to even more than simply excavator drivers. If you have a vehicle come in with a target of 23 heaps, your driver can fill their pail and dynamically evaluate itoften without also being stationary.


This means the driver can see the exact weight of the lots they're regarding to dump (topcon gps). On-board weighing offers real-time understanding right into the container's load to make overloading, underloading, reweighing and waiting times a thing of the past. Volvo Construction EquipmentIf they unload 12 tons on the very first pass, the next container needs to weigh 11 bunches

A lot of procedures utilize an on-board evaluating application to make sure that the load is accurate prior to they send their trucks to the ranges, which is vital since the range weight is what's used for billing and invoicing objectives. A number of manufacturers consist of some kind of evaluating program on their loaders. Some additionally have attributes that enable companies to keep track of and control the overall loads of multiple vehicles.
